Output d59296e77dfd28d9d8b7ae837ef5be875c63a00ec495c292243f7aee9db8e5ab:0

value
999727
script pubkey
OP_0 OP_PUSHBYTES_20 f622672a1670f49ab9ccacb418d6b4a69b8111b1
address
bc1q7c3xw2skwr6f4wwv4j6p344556dczyd3muv32a
transaction
d59296e77dfd28d9d8b7ae837ef5be875c63a00ec495c292243f7aee9db8e5ab
confirmations
1739
spent
true